[The Gass Schmiede Photograph #3]

Description: Photograph of The Gass Schmiede, in Comfort, Texas. Two young girls wearing gingham dresses stand behind a male toddler sitting in a sheep-drawn toy wagon. A handwritten note on the back of the photo reads "Standing L-R "Minnie" Ingenhuett and Ida Ingenhuett, Boy in wagon - Warren Ingenhuett." A typed note on the reverse side also states, "Notice "wooden steps" leading to second floor on south side of building."

[Postcard to Mrs. Emil Philippus, April 28, 1921]

Description: Postcard to Mrs. Emil Philippus, discussing arrangements for Mrs. Philippus to meet her mother-in-law at the depot on May 8, 1921. The front of the postcard features a photograph of the Holy Angels Academy in Boerne, Texas, a two-story, light-colored wood building with wrap-around porches on both stories. There is a small tower extending from the center of the roof of the building, and a short flagpole at the front of the roof. There is a large group of students and nuns standing on the first-f… more
